In Evian-les-Bains, France, leaders at the Group of Seven (G7) summit are considering a renewed focus on the conflict in Ukraine. This comes as President Donald Trump contemplates reinstating sanctions on Russian oil shipments. The recent emphasis on the Iran conflict shifted attention away from Ukraine. However, Trump aims to refocus discussions after announcing a ceasefire agreement in the Gulf region.
Trump expressed that the situation with Iran will soon be less prominent. He mentioned that sanctions relaxed during the Iran conflict could return as the oil flow through the Strait of Hormuz recovers. Speaking at a bilateral meeting with the Emir of Qatar, Trump noted the potential for swift reimplementation of these sanctions, emphasizing the strategic timing as oil markets stabilize.
The U.S. previously eased sanctions in response to rising crude prices. The temporary waiver extended to allow more oil movement is now being reassessed.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y joined G7 talks, underscoring the importance of global support for Ukraine amid ongoing tensions with Russia. Zelenskyy highlighted the unanimous backing from G7 members and stressed Ukraine’s commitment to peace, despite Russia’s tactics.
Discussions included increasing the production of Patriot missiles, essential in defending against Russian attacks on Ukraine’s power grid and urban areas. While the U.S. has scaled back aid, countries like France lead in providing military and financial assistance to Kyiv.
Meanwhile, the UK is implementing new sanctions targeting Russia’s covert transportation networks for oil and gas. These measures aim to undermine Moscow’s financial strategies, particularly those linked to the Arctic LNG 2 project.
Hours before the summit, Russia intensified missile and drone attacks on major Ukrainian cities, resulting in 11 casualties and significant destruction. The aggressive actions preceded conversations between Zelenskyy, Putin, and Trump, marking the latter’s 80th birthday.
As Trump campaigns for another presidential term, he claims he can resolve the Russia-Ukraine conflict swiftly. However, ongoing negotiations prove challenging. Concurrently, Ukraine initiated European Union membership talks, advancing towards long-term security and stability. Still, NATO membership remains contentious, with existing members cautious during the ongoing conflict.
The U.S.-Iran agreement, part of the summit dialogue, sees Trump open to Congressional review, though specifics remain undisclosed. Despite skepticism from some Republicans regarding Iran’s nuclear intentions, Trump seeks legislative approval.
In other meetings, Trump expressed dissatisfaction with Israel’s handling of Hezbollah in Lebanon, criticizing prolonged military actions. Meanwhile, French President Emmanuel Macron indicated readiness to restore maritime security swiftly if needed, emphasizing peaceful resolution in oil transport regions greatly affected by rising prices.
The G7 includes France, the United States, Canada, Germany, Italy, Japan, and the United Kingdom, with additional nations like Brazil, India, Kenya, and South Korea participating in select discussions.
